暗号資産(仮想通貨)の基礎知識:ブロックチェーン技術入門
暗号資産(仮想通貨)は、デジタルまたは仮想的な通貨であり、暗号化技術を使用して取引の安全性を確保し、新しいユニットの生成を制御します。その根幹技術であるブロックチェーンは、単なる金融技術にとどまらず、様々な分野での応用が期待されています。本稿では、暗号資産の基礎知識と、それを支えるブロックチェーン技術について、専門的な視点から詳細に解説します。
1. 暗号資産(仮想通貨)とは
暗号資産は、中央銀行のような中央機関によって発行または管理されるのではなく、分散型ネットワーク上で動作します。これにより、検閲耐性、透明性、セキュリティといった特徴を持ちます。代表的な暗号資産としては、ビットコイン(Bitcoin)、イーサリアム(Ethereum)、リップル(Ripple)などが挙げられます。これらの暗号資産は、それぞれ異なる目的と技術的基盤を持っています。
1.1 暗号資産の種類
暗号資産は、その機能や目的に応じて様々な種類に分類できます。
- ビットコイン(Bitcoin): 最初の暗号資産であり、主に価値の保存手段として利用されます。
- アルトコイン(Altcoin): ビットコイン以外の暗号資産の総称です。イーサリアム、リップル、ライトコインなどが含まれます。
- ステーブルコイン(Stablecoin): 米ドルやユーロなどの法定通貨に価値をペッグすることで、価格変動を抑えた暗号資産です。USDT、USDCなどが代表的です。
- セキュリティトークン(Security Token): 株式や債券などの金融商品をトークン化したもので、証券規制の対象となります。
- ユーティリティトークン(Utility Token): 特定のプラットフォームやサービスを利用するための権利を表すトークンです。
1.2 暗号資産のメリットとデメリット
暗号資産は、従来の金融システムと比較して、いくつかのメリットとデメリットがあります。
メリット
- 分散性: 中央機関による管理がないため、検閲や不正操作のリスクが低い。
- 透明性: ブロックチェーン上にすべての取引履歴が記録されるため、透明性が高い。
- セキュリティ: 暗号化技術により、取引の安全性が確保される。
- 低コスト: 国際送金などの手数料が低い場合がある。
- 金融包摂: 銀行口座を持たない人々でも金融サービスを利用できる可能性がある。
デメリット
- 価格変動性: 価格変動が激しく、投資リスクが高い。
- 規制の不確実性: 各国での規制が整備途上であり、不確実性が高い。
- スケーラビリティ問題: 取引処理能力が低い場合があり、送金に時間がかかることがある。
- セキュリティリスク: ウォレットのハッキングや詐欺などのリスクがある。
- 複雑性: 技術的な理解が必要であり、初心者には敷居が高い。
2. ブロックチェーン技術の基礎
ブロックチェーンは、暗号資産を支える基盤技術であり、分散型台帳技術(Distributed Ledger Technology: DLT)の一種です。ブロックチェーンは、複数のブロックが鎖のように連結された構造を持ち、各ブロックには取引データが記録されます。この構造により、データの改ざんが極めて困難になり、高いセキュリティが実現されます。
2.1 ブロックチェーンの仕組み
ブロックチェーンの基本的な仕組みは以下の通りです。
- 取引の発生: あるユーザーが別のユーザーに暗号資産を送金するなどの取引が発生します。
- 取引の検証: ネットワーク上のノード(コンピュータ)が取引の正当性を検証します。
- ブロックの生成: 検証された取引データは、ブロックにまとめられます。
- ブロックの追加: 新しいブロックは、既存のブロックチェーンに追加されます。この際、暗号化技術を用いて、ブロック間の整合性が確保されます。
- ブロックチェーンの共有: ブロックチェーンは、ネットワーク上のすべてのノードに共有されます。
2.2 ブロックチェーンの種類
ブロックチェーンは、そのアクセス権限や参加主体によって、いくつかの種類に分類できます。
- パブリックブロックチェーン(Public Blockchain): 誰でも参加できるオープンなブロックチェーンです。ビットコインやイーサリアムなどが該当します。
- プライベートブロックチェーン(Private Blockchain): 特定の組織や企業のみが参加できるブロックチェーンです。
- コンソーシアムブロックチェーン(Consortium Blockchain): 複数の組織や企業が共同で管理するブロックチェーンです。
2.3 コンセンサスアルゴリズム
ブロックチェーン上で新しいブロックを追加する際には、ネットワーク上のノード間で合意形成を行う必要があります。この合意形成の仕組みをコンセンサスアルゴリズムと呼びます。代表的なコンセンサスアルゴリズムとしては、以下のものがあります。
- プルーフ・オブ・ワーク(Proof of Work: PoW): 計算問題を解くことで、新しいブロックを追加する権利を得る仕組みです。ビットコインで採用されています。
- プルーフ・オブ・ステーク(Proof of Stake: PoS): 暗号資産の保有量に応じて、新しいブロックを追加する権利を得る仕組みです。イーサリアム2.0で採用されています。
- デリゲーテッド・プルーフ・オブ・ステーク(Delegated Proof of Stake: DPoS): 投票によって選ばれた代表者が、新しいブロックを追加する仕組みです。
3. スマートコントラクト
スマートコントラクトは、ブロックチェーン上で実行されるプログラムであり、特定の条件が満たされた場合に自動的に契約を実行します。これにより、仲介者なしで安全かつ効率的に取引を行うことができます。イーサリアムは、スマートコントラクトの実行に特化したプラットフォームであり、DeFi(分散型金融)などの分野で広く利用されています。
3.1 スマートコントラクトの仕組み
スマートコントラクトは、事前に定義されたルールに基づいて自動的に実行されます。例えば、あるユーザーが特定の金額をスマートコントラクトに送金した場合、自動的に別のユーザーに別の金額を送金する、といった処理を記述することができます。スマートコントラクトは、一度デプロイされると、その内容を変更することはできません。これにより、改ざんのリスクを低減し、信頼性を高めることができます。
3.2 スマートコントラクトの応用例
スマートコントラクトは、様々な分野で応用されています。
- DeFi(分散型金融): 貸付、借入、取引などの金融サービスを、仲介者なしで提供します。
- サプライチェーン管理: 製品の追跡や品質管理を、透明かつ効率的に行います。
- 投票システム: 安全かつ公正な投票システムを構築します。
- デジタル著作権管理: デジタルコンテンツの著作権を保護します。
4. 暗号資産の将来展望
暗号資産とブロックチェーン技術は、まだ発展途上の段階にありますが、その潜在力は非常に大きいと言えます。規制の整備が進み、技術的な課題が解決されることで、暗号資産は、従来の金融システムを補完し、より効率的で透明性の高い社会を実現するための重要なツールとなる可能性があります。また、ブロックチェーン技術は、金融分野だけでなく、サプライチェーン管理、医療、不動産など、様々な分野での応用が期待されています。
今後の課題としては、スケーラビリティ問題の解決、セキュリティリスクの低減、規制の明確化などが挙げられます。これらの課題を克服することで、暗号資産とブロックチェーン技術は、より多くの人々に利用され、社会に貢献していくことが期待されます。
結論: 暗号資産とブロックチェーン技術は、金融システムや社会構造に大きな変革をもたらす可能性を秘めています。これらの技術を理解し、適切に活用することで、より良い未来を築くことができるでしょう。